How Does Bollinger Bands Analysis Apply to Options?

We break down how these three lines—a moving average and two standard deviation channels—expand and contract with market volatility. Discover the famous "Bollinger Band Squeeze" and how it can signal that a stock is coiled up for an explosive move. Most importantly, we'll explain the "dual utility" for options traders: using the bands not just for directional clues, but also to gauge whether options are currently cheap (a good time to buy) or expensive (a good time to sell).

Key Takeaways

  • They Are a "Mood Ring" for Volatility: Bollinger Bands are a dynamic tool that visually represents a stock's volatility. When the bands are wide, volatility is high. When the bands contract and get very tight, volatility is low—this is known as "The Squeeze" and often precedes a significant price move.
  • The Squeeze Signals a Move, But Not Direction: A Bollinger Band Squeeze is a powerful signal that a stock is building energy for a potential breakout. However, the squeeze itself does not predict which way the price will break. You must use other tools like trend analysis or support/resistance for directional confirmation.
  • The "Dual Utility" for Options Traders: Bollinger Bands are uniquely powerful for options traders. They provide 1) Volatility Awareness: helping you gauge if options are cheap (narrow bands) or expensive (wide bands), which informs whether you should be a buyer or a seller. And 2) Better Timing: helping you spot potential breakouts from a squeeze.
  • Match the Strategy to the Bands: The state of the bands helps guide your strategy choice. 1) The Squeeze:Consider buying calls or puts on a confirmed breakout. 2) Wide Bands: Consider selling premium with credit spreads or iron condors to take advantage of high implied volatility. 3) Mean Reversion: Look for confirmed reversals from the outer bands to trade back toward the middle moving average.
  • Use Them with Confirmation (Never in Isolation): Bollinger Bands are not a standalone system. They are most effective when used in "confluence" with other forms of analysis, such as volume, classic support and resistance levels, and momentum indicators like RSI.

"Volatility profoundly affects option prices, which means Bollinger Bands offer this kind of dual utility for options traders. It's not just direction, it's also about the price of volatility."
